Best Time for a Tranquil Vow Exchange at Lago Di Braies

Lago Di Braies (or Brasger Wildersee in German) is CROWDED during the day, so we made sure to be there by sunrise. Parking for the entire day is just 8 euros at the second carpark from the lake (as of June 2024), making it convenient for a full-day adventure.

The crystal-clear waters reflect the majestic mountains, creating a perfect backdrop for intimate and dreamy photos. We spend two magical hours here, taking advantage of the tranquil morning light before the crowds arrive.

TIP: Visiting on a weekday between October and May can be quieter than in the summer months. The photos featured in this blog were shot in May.

Eloping in Europe

Before we continue on our journey around Lago Di Braies, a quick note on the legalities! If you’re looking to elope in Europe, be sure to check that your country recognises the marriage license from the country you’re eloping in! You might want to get legally married in your home country and do a vow exchange for your overseas elopement. The Boathouse and Boat Rental

If you’re looking for an exclusive experience, The Boathouse and the dock are available for exclusive hire 1.5 hours before the official boat rental hours begin each day. This includes the rental of two wooden boats. For exact pricing, dates and online booking, check out La Palafitta, the official dock and boat rental website. There’s only one slot available per day for the exclusive hire of the Boathouse.

Alternatively, you could hire a boat only, but it would be once they officially open, so other tourists will be on the lake. Each boat can take up to 5 people. Note: You CANNOT reserve a boat.

But if neither of you are particularly keen on getting in a boat, let me remind you - you can make your elopement experience whatever you like! For example, there are hiking trails around the lake with gorgeous spots for photos, and you don’t need to worry about a special booking or permit.

The Chapel

Built in 1904, this beautiful chapel stands near the end of the lake path. But it’s not just a cute chapel! During World War II, 137 political prisoners were brought there from German concentration camps by the SS commander in chief who hoped to exchange them for his own safety. The rich history and Romanesque architecture of the chapel adds a unique touch to your elopement experience. There’s just something about a building that has stood the test of time! Two hundred and twenty years, to be exact! If you haven’t already exchanged vows at the lake, this would be a great spot to do just that.
